Comprehending Windows in Doors
Windows in doors, frequently described as "door lights" or "glazed doors," are glass panes incorporated into a door's structure. These windows can vary in size and style, ranging from little panels to large, full-length areas. The glass can be clear, frosted, or tinted, enabling homeowners to customize their doors according to their preferences.

Types of Windows in Doors
Windows in doors come in various designs and performances. The following table summarizes the different kinds of windows typically found in doors.
Kind of Window | Description | Finest Suited For |
---|---|---|
Clear Glass | Offers optimum presence and light | Entry doors, outdoor patio doors |
Frosted Glass | Uses privacy while still allowing light | Restroom doors, bedrooms |
Tinted Glass | Reduces glare and heat while preserving some presence | Sunrooms, exterior doors |
Leaded Glass | Ornamental glass with soldered metal or colored glass | Conventional homes |
Triple-Glazed | Enhances energy efficiency with 3 panes | Energy-efficient styles |
Stained Glass | Artistic panels that add character and design | Entry doors, decorative entranceways |

Factors To Consider for Installing Windows in Doors
While including windows to doors supplies distinct advantages, homeowners must think about several elements before making a decision:
Security: Choose tempered or laminated glass to improve safety and toughness.
Energy Efficiency: Look for doors with insulated windows to reduce energy loss.
Upkeep: Assess the ease of cleaning and maintenance, especially if selecting decorative or complex styles.
Building Codes: Always check local building policies to make sure compliance when installing new doors.
Design Compatibility: Select a design that aligns with the home's general architectural design.
